FIRE Welcomes Bridget Sweeney!
I am very pleased to announce that FIRE has welcomed the newest member of our team, my new assistant, Bridget Sweeney. Bridget comes to FIRE with great experience, intelligence, and enthusiasm for our mission.
After graduating cum laude from Fordham University with a B.A. in History and Political Science, Bridget worked as a press officer at the Manhattan Institute for Policy Research in New York City. While there, she focused on issues such as culture, immigration, and higher education. In 2009, she returned to Fordham University to pursue an M.A. in Modern European History, completing her Master's thesis on the intersection of socialist and feminist ideologies in late 19th century Britain.
Bridget's passion for the study of competing ideologies and her commitment to the preservation of liberty on America's college campuses make her a perfect addition to FIRE's staff. I speak for all of us here when I say that I am thrilled to have Bridget as part of our team. Welcome, Bridget!
